The Community of Esopus

Esopus was named from the Native American word “esepu” which means “high banks”.  Beautifully situated on the west banks of the majestic Hudson River, Esopus is approximately 100 miles North of New York City. It is bounded to the North by the Rondout Creek which is home to the Kingston Strand with shopping and many fine restaurants. In addition to the Hudson and Walkill Rivers, the Rondout, Black, and Swartekill Creeks all wind through Esopus. It is a short ride to Kingston, Poughkeepsie and New Palts which all offer fine dining and diverse shopping. For recreation there is easy access to boating on the Hudson River and Rondout Creek with both Minnewaska State Park and the Mohonk Preserve a short ride away.
